采用外周血淋巴细胞培养及G带染色体标本制作技术,研究和分析华南虎(Panthera tigris amoyensis)染色体的核型和带型。结果表明:华南虎二倍体染色体数为 2n=38条,其中常染色体18对,性染色体1对。常染色体按相对长度从长到短依次编号为1~18。根据着丝粒指数可将华南虎染色体分为4组,即A组(m),包括2、5、13、18和X;B组(Sm),包括1、4、7、8、9、10、11、12、14、17和Y;C组(St),包括3、6;D组(t),包括15、16。核型公式为8(m)+20(Sm)

Male infertility with chromosomal abnormalities. III. 46, XYq- [PDF]
A deletion of the long arm of the Y chromosome (46, XYq-) was found in two cases with normal male habitus but with azoospermia. The first case was of a 28-year-old married man, an office worker, complaining of infertility.

人类Y染色体是一条小的近端着丝粒染色体,通过流式细胞仪方法测得Y染色体长约由60Mb,其组成分为两个区域:拟常染色质区和Y特异区,特异区占Y染色体的大部分易发生形态学变化。
